How to clean our sterling silver chains?
To clean our sterling silver chains, first, mix a solution of mild dish soap and warm water. Then, gently scrub the chain with a soft-bristled toothbrush or cloth to remove dirt and debris. Rinse the chain thoroughly with clean water and pat dry with a soft cloth. For stubborn tarnish, consider using a silver polishing cloth or a silver cleaning solution following the manufacturer's instructions.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ive materials that may damage the silver. Finally, store the chain in a dry, tarnish-resistant pouch or cloth to prevent further tarnishing.
How to know if a chain is made of pure silver?
Firstly, look for hallmark stamps such as "925" or "Sterling" on the chain, indicating that it is made of sterling silver, which is 92.5% pure silver. You can also use a magnet; pure silver is non-magnetic, so if the chain is attracted to the magnet, it likely contains other metals. Additionally, you can conduct a nitric acid test by applying a drop of nitric acid to a discreet area of the chain. If the area turns green, it suggests that the chain is not pure silver, as silver does not react with nitric acid. However, please note that these tests should be conducted with caution and ideally by a professional jeweler for accurate results.
How many types of silver chains exist?
There are numerous types of silver chains available, each with its own unique design and characteristics. Some common types include the bold and masculine Cuban link chain, characterized by interlocking flat and symmetrical links, the classic rope chain with its twisted design resembling a rope or twisted strands of metal, the sleek and smooth box chain consisting of square links, the durable and sturdy curb chain featuring flattened, twisted links, the eye-catching Figaro chain with alternating long and short links, and the elegant snake chain known for its sleek and flexible appearance created by smooth, round links. These are just a few examples of the wide variety of silver chains available, each offering its own style and aesthetic appeal.
How to choose the right silver chain for men or women?
When choosing a silver chain for either men or women, there are several factors to consider. Firstly, consider the style and aesthetic preferences of the wearer. Men may prefer bolder and more substantial chains, such as a Cuban link or curb chain, while women may opt for more delicate and intricate designs, such as a rope or box chain. Additionally, consider the occasion for which the chain will be worn; for everyday wear, a durable and sturdy chain may be more suitable, while for special occasions, a more ornate and decorative chain may be desired. It's also important to consider the length and width of the chain, as well as the quality of the silver and craftsmanship.
